GRAVES, GUSTAV

Contributed by: The James Bond Movie Encyclopedia by Steven Jay Rubin

Impossibly rich and extremely smarmy environmental entrepreneur portrayed by Toby Stephens in Die Another Day. On the surface, Graves appears determined to turn the world’s icy reaches into gardens with a satellite-mounted heat ray, which goes through glaciers like a knife through butter. With such a working device, he manages to impress the scientific community as well as the queen of England, who knights him.

But appearances are deceiving. Graves is actually renegade North Korean officer Colonel Moon, who has gone through a radical form of gene replacement therapy that has completely altered his appearance. Graves/Moon’s intention is to use the satellite to blow a hole in the demilitarized zone between North and South Korea, paving the way for a full-scale invasion of the south. In addition to operating a dangerous satellite, Graves is also a member of the Blades fencing club in London—where he challenges 007 to a deadly match—the highlight of the film.
